Bear Creek Mining appoints CFO

20th December 2023 By: Creamer Media Reporter

Gold and silver miner Bear Creek Mining Corporation has appointed Fernando Ragone CFO, with effect from December 18.

Ragone, a mining finance executive with 28 years of experience, has held senior executive positions at numerous large companies in Canada, Peru, Mexico, the US, Argentina, Australia and Europe.

He most recently held the position of CFO at Baffinland Iron Mines, before which he served in senior roles at First Majestic Silver, leading the Finance and Business Improvement teams. Prior to that, he spent 14 years at Glencore working in several countries and roles culminating in his position as CFO for Glencore North American Zinc.

"I am pleased to welcome Fernando Ragone to the company. Fernando is an accomplished and experienced financial expert who will be an integral member of our senior management team as we work to establish our Mercedes gold mine as a consistent free cash flow-generating operation and as we coordinate project financing that will allow for construction of the Corani mine in Peru - one of the largest fully permitted silver projects in the world.

"We sincerely thank Paul Tweddle, the company's outgoing CFO, for his service, dedication and contributions to the company since March 2018," Bear Creek president and CEO Eric Caba comments.
